Library missing menu items, imported files
I am using Video Studio Pro x7 (for the first time) with Windows 7 Home Premium.
All work was performed under the library's 'edit' tab.
Started with the Quick Start section of the manual, imported three video files from my hard drive into the library and created a folder to store them. Played around with the timeline and clipping videos. The next day, I removed all of the videos files from the library to repeat the process to make sure I understood what I was doing. This is where I ran into problems.
First of all, the '+ add' button was missing, as was the folder I had created. I imported a video file (several times) and it never appeared in the library. I checked and re-checked the 'Hide titles', 'hide videos' and 'hide music' buttons but no change. I reset the library settings three times and no change. Also reset the program settings to their defaults with no change. The videos, and the '+ add' button were still missing.
What am I doing wrong or not doing?

Re: Library missing menu items, imported files
If you look closely at Brian's photo above, you will see a thin pale grey vertical line to the immediate left of all the thumbnails. I suspect yours has somehow or other been dragged over to sit to the immediate right of the the black vertical column containing the Media, Instant Projects, Transitions etc icons. If you hover your mouse over the grey line (if it is there!!) the cursor changes into a pair of vertical lines with arrows on either side. Left click and hold, then drag the grey line to the right. This should expose the + Add, Samples etc buttons.
If you can't see that grey line, then look down to the bottom left corner of the library window -- see the red arrow in my attached image. Left Click on that arrow button (which points right). That will reveal your missing column as well.

Re: Library missing menu items, imported files
I'd noticed that arrow but kept trying to drag it, to no avail. However, in a 'oh yeah' moment, with a great assist from Ken, I doubled click on the arrow and voila, what was lost, is now found.
